CentOS系统在VPS中的使用指南 (vps中的centos系统怎么使用)

在互联网时代,随着计算机的不断发展和普及,云计算正在成为一种新的计算范式,而VPS则是云计算中的一种重要形式。VPS(Virtual Private Server)即虚拟专用服务器,是一种虚拟化技术,可以在一台服务器上,运行多个独立的虚拟服务器。而CentOS则是一种优秀的开源操作系统,兼容性好、稳定性强,因此在VPS中广受欢迎。本文将为大家介绍。

一、CentOS系统的安装

1.选择合适的VPS服务商,并购买合适的VPS服务器。

2.选择适合的CentOS版本,可以到官网下载ISO镜像,也可以在安装过程中直接通过网络获取。

3.将下载好的ISO镜像文件写入U盘或CD/DVD光盘,并将VPS服务器引导到U盘或CD/DVD光盘。

4.进入启动模式选择菜单,选择“Install CentOS”开始安装CentOS系统。

5.根据安装程序提示,设置时区、语言以及root用户密码等基本信息。

6.对硬盘进行分区并安装CentOS系统。

二、CentOS系统的配置

1.配置网络设置

CentOS系统需要通过网络进行远程连接和下载安装包等操作,因此需要对网络进行配置。可以在安装时配置,也可以在安装后通过命令行配置。

– 修改/etc/sysconfig/network-scripts/ifcfg-eth0文件,设置IP地址、网关、DNS等网络参数。

– 在命令行下执行ifconfig命令,启用网卡。

– 使用ping命令测试网络连接是否正常。

2.配置软件仓库

CentOS系统需要安装各种软件包,而这些软件包是从软件仓库中下载的。为了能够顺利地下载安装软件包,需要配置正确的软件仓库。

– 修改/etc/yum.repos.d/CentOS-Base.repo文件,选择合适的软件源(国内用户建议使用国内的软件源)。

– 使用yum命令更新软件包信息。

3.安装常用软件

安装常用软件可以满足日常使用的需求,建议安装以下软件:

– ssh:用于远程登录和管理服务器。

– vim:一款强大的文本编辑器,适合程序员使用。

– wget:用于从网络下载文件。

– screen:用于在终端中打开多个会话。

4.配置SSH

SSH是安全远程连接到服务器的协议,基于非对称加密技术,能够提供安全的通信方式。配置SSH需要进行以下步骤:

– 修改/etc/ssh/sshd_config文件,禁用root用户远程登录、修改ssh端口等。

– 重启SSH服务,使用ssh命令测试是否能够登录。

– 将SSH私钥保存在本地,使用ssh-keygen命令生成公钥并上传至服务器。

– 配置ssh配置文件~/.ssh/config,方便快捷地登录服务器。

5.配置防火墙

为了保障服务器的安全,需要使用防火墙保护服务器,防止恶意攻击。CentOS系统自带的防火墙为iptables,可以通过以下步骤进行配置:

– 查看防火墙状态:service iptables status。

– 设定规则:iptables -A INPUT -p tcp –dport 端口号 -j ACCEPT。

– 将规则保存并重启iptables服务:service iptables save;service iptables restart。

三、CentOS系统的维护和备份

1.系统维护

维护服务器可以确保服务器的稳定性和安全性,以下是一些维护方法:

– 定期更新软件包,保持系统的安全性。

– 定期清理日志文件和缓存文件,释放磁盘空间。

– 定期备份数据,防止数据丢失。

2.数据备份

数据备份是非常重要的,防止数据丢失或损坏。以下是一些备份方法:

– 将重要的数据保存在云存储中,如阿里云OSS、百度云等。

– 使用备份软件,如rsync、tar等进行备份。

– 使用服务商提供的备份服务,如阿里云的云盾备份等。

结语

本文简单介绍了,从安装、配置、维护、备份等方面进行了详细讲解,并提供了一些实用方法和技巧。希望对读者在使用VPS服务器过程中有所帮助。


数据运维技术 » CentOS系统在VPS中的使用指南 (vps中的centos系统怎么使用)